Every summer the same problem, one must protect the skin from the sun, but without forgetting the hair. They too, like the skin on the face suffer from excessive exposure to ultraviolet rays, only that the damage does not manifest itself immediately, they cannot get burnt, but reveals itself after the summer, when the hair becomes dry, brittle, fragile and often has split ends. They can also lose their shine, becoming dull and taking on a messy appearance. In addition, the colour may fade or take on a straw effect, especially if the hair has been exposed to the sun, chlorine from swimming pools or salt water from the sea without adequate protection.

Not only that, in autumn, a fall can also occur. The reasons? The change of season and the result of incorrect exposure to UV rays, which causes stress on the hair follicles and an increase in the production of free radicals, leading to more hair loss than usual. However, there is no shortage of remedies. If you protect your hair properly, you can expose yourself to the sun without any problems, counteracting degenerative processes and enjoying the benefits of Vitamin D - sunlight increases its production, which is indispensable for the body, including the hair.

The main damage caused by the sun

.

An important premise: the sun's rays, and ultraviolet rays in particular, damage the hair shaft, but do not spare the scalp either. "At the level of the hair shaft, we observe thinning, dryness, dehydration, loss of colour and poor shine," explains Matteo Orlando, hairstylist at the Mastromauro Beauty Salon in Milan. "If we stay in the sun for many days, the hair also tends to become more fragile and split ends form. In addition, these effects are accentuated if we repeatedly wet our heads, a very common action to find refreshment. Water increases the porosity of the hair and the sun's rays are able to reach deep into the hair, increasing the drying and weakening effect. This is why adequate protection is needed for all hair types, whether curly or straight, and whether we are at the seaside or in the mountains'.

360 degree protection

.

Protect, repair, brighten, these are the three key words to keep in mind. "To protect your hair from the sun's rays, you can use a product with UV protection, there are several on the market," continues the hairstylist. "These products work in a similar way to what they do on the skin. The UV filter is contained in a spray that you spray on your hair. The important thing is to apply it often enough, which is also useful to carry in your bag. You can also choose nourishing products with an after sun effect to breathe new life into sun-stressed hair. To further strengthen the hair, a pack with almond oil and shea butter is ideal to provide moisture, while a pack with castor, argan or coconut oil nourishes the lengths and ends. And the styling tools? If you can avoid them, it's better because they cause additional stress on the hair. If you can't do without them, apply a heat protector before styling. To keep the hair colour vibrant and prevent fading, there are pigment masks that not only soften the hair but also tone it, but in this case you have to follow your hairdresser's advice.
